5.11 Check tightness
Danger! Danger of life from gas!
The entire gas inlet pipe, particularly the joints must be checked for leakages be-
fore commissioning.
5.11.1 Purging the gas line
The gas line has to be purged before commissioning. For this, open the measuring
nozzle for the connecting pressure and purge by observing the safety precautions.
Check for tightness of the connection after purging!
5.12 Factory settings
The set gas type can be seen on the affixed label on the burner. The data, set by
the manufacturer, has to be checked with the local supply conditions before insta-
lation of the Paramount. The gas pressure controller of the gas valve has been
sealed.
5.13 Supply pressure
The supply pressure must lie between the following values:
- for natural gas: 18 mbar - 25 mbar
- for liquid gas: nominal 37mbar
The connecting pressure is measured as pressure in the gas flow at the measuring
nozzle of the gas valve ( Fig. 9 ).
Danger! Danger of life by gas!
The Paramount must not be started up when the supply pressures are outside the
said range!
The gas supply company should be informed.
5.14 CO2 -Content
The CO
2
content in the exhaust gas must be checked during commissioning and
during regular maintenance of the boiler, as well as, after reconstruction work on
the boiler or on the exhaust gas system.
CO
2
-content during operation see section Technical data.
Caution! Risk of damage of the burner!
Too high CO
2
-values can lead to incomplete combustion (high CO-values) and
damage to the burner.
Too low CO
2
-values can lead to ignition problems.
The CO
2
-value has to be set by modifying the gas pressure at the gas valve (see
Fig. 9 ).
The air quantity set in the factory must not be changed.
5.15
Changing over from LPG to
natural gas and vice versa
Danger! Danger of life by gas!
The gas type of the Paramount must only be modified by an approved heating spe-
cialist. Use the BRÖTJE conversion set for LPG (accessory). The instructions of the
conversion kit must be observed!
The CO
2
-content has to be set by adjusting the nozzle pressure at the gas valve
(see section Guide line for nozzle pressure)
The CO
2
-content must be between the values according to section Technical Data
at full load as well as low load.
